National Exam Pass Rate Decreases
Monday, 23 June 2008

There are schools with zero passing rates.

JAKARTA, Republika -The 2008 National Exam results from high schools (SMA) and specialized high schools (SMK), which were announced on Saturday (6/14), are not yet satisfying. On the national level, the passing rate decreased from 93 percent to 92 percent. A couple of thousands of students failed, some schools even had zero passing rates for several majors.

The Lateness of the Certification Disadvantage Teachers
Monday, 16 June 2008

New Subsidiary for 38.000 Teachers
JAKARTA. Kompas - The government is asked to be responsible on the lateness of certification test of almost 200.000 teachers in the 2006 and 2007 quota. The problem is that there are so many teachers that have been claimed to pass the certification, but have not received any teachers’ profession subsidiary that worth of one month salary.
